Effective Web Design Tips for Ethical Hackers
Welcome to our blog post on "Effective Web Design Tips for Ethical Hackers"! If you’re an ethical hacker looking to enhance your website’s design while maintaining the highest standards of security, you’ve come to the right place. In today’s digital age, a visually appealing and user-friendly website is essential for any business or individual. However, as an ethical hacker, you also understand the importance of ensuring the safety and integrity of your website. This blog post will provide you with valuable tips and insights on how to design a website that is both aesthetically pleasing and secure.
Without further ado, let’s dive into the world of web design for ethical hackers and explore the best practices that will help you create an effective online presence.
Table of Contents
- Understanding the Importance of Web Design for Ethical Hackers
- Choosing the Right Color Palette and Typography
- Creating a User-Friendly Interface
- Incorporating Secure Features into Your Design
- Optimizing Your Website for Mobile Devices
- Enhancing Website Performance and Speed
- Implementing Effective Call-to-Actions
- Utilizing SEO Strategies for Ethical Hackers
- Frequently Asked Questions (FAQ)
- Conclusion
1. Understanding the Importance of Web Design for Ethical Hackers
In the digital landscape, a website serves as the face of any organization or individual. For ethical hackers, it is important to create a strong online presence that reflects your professionalism and expertise. A well-designed website not only attracts visitors but also instills confidence in your audience. It conveys the message that you take security seriously and are dedicated to providing a safe environment for your users.
2. Choosing the Right Color Palette and Typography
When it comes to web design, color and typography play a crucial role in creating an appealing visual experience. For ethical hackers, it is essential to choose colors that evoke a sense of trust and reliability. Opt for a color palette that includes shades of blue, green, and grey, as they are often associated with security and stability. Additionally, consider the psychology behind color choices to create the desired emotional response from your audience.
In terms of typography, it is important to select fonts that are easily readable and convey professionalism. Stick to a maximum of two font families to maintain consistency throughout your website. Sans-serif fonts are generally preferred for their clean and modern look. Remember, legibility is key when it comes to communicating your message effectively.
3. Creating a User-Friendly Interface
User experience should be at the forefront of your web design strategy. A user-friendly interface ensures that visitors can easily navigate your website and find the information they need. Here are some tips to create a seamless user experience:
- Simplify navigation: Keep your website’s navigation simple and intuitive. Use clear labels and organize your content into logical categories.
- Use whitespace: Whitespace, or negative space, is the empty space between elements on a webpage. It helps improve readability and allows users to focus on the important content.
- Incorporate clear headings and subheadings: Break your content into sections and use descriptive headings and subheadings to guide users through your website.
- Include search functionality: If your website has a large amount of content, consider adding a search bar to help users quickly find what they are looking for.
4. Incorporating Secure Features into Your Design
As an ethical hacker, security should be a top priority for your website. Here are some essential secure features to incorporate into your design:
- SSL/TLS encryption: Implement secure socket layer (SSL) or transport layer security (TLS) encryption to protect sensitive data transmitted between your website and users.
- Two-factor authentication: Provide an additional layer of security by implementing two-factor authentication for user logins.
- Secure login forms: Use secure methods to handle user login and authentication, such as hashing and salting passwords.
- Regular security updates: Stay up to date with the latest security patches and updates to ensure your website is protected against vulnerabilities.
5. Optimizing Your Website for Mobile Devices
With the increasing use of smartphones and tablets, it is crucial to design your website to be mobile-friendly. Mobile optimization improves user experience and allows your website to reach a wider audience. Here are some key considerations for mobile optimization:
- Responsive design: Ensure your website is responsive and adapts to different screen sizes and resolutions.
- Mobile-friendly navigation: Simplify navigation for mobile users by using hamburger menus or other mobile-friendly navigation patterns.
- Fast loading times: Optimize your website’s performance to reduce loading times on mobile devices. Compress images, minify code, and leverage caching to improve speed.
6. Enhancing Website Performance and Speed
Website performance not only affects user experience but also plays a role in search engine optimization (SEO) rankings. Here are some tips to enhance your website’s performance and speed:
- Optimize images: Compress images without compromising quality to reduce their file size and improve loading times.
- Minify code: Remove unnecessary spaces, comments, and line breaks from your HTML, CSS, and JavaScript files to reduce their size.
- Enable caching: Leverage browser caching to store static files, such as images and scripts, on a user’s device, reducing the need for repeated downloads.
- Use a content delivery network (CDN): Distribute your website’s files across multiple servers worldwide to reduce latency and improve loading times for users in different locations.
7. Implementing Effective Call-to-Actions
Call-to-actions (CTAs) are essential elements of web design that prompt users to take specific actions. Whether it’s signing up for a newsletter, making a purchase, or downloading a resource, effective CTAs increase user engagement and conversion rates. Here are some tips for implementing effective CTAs:
- Use descriptive and action-oriented language: Clearly communicate the benefit or value users will receive by clicking on the CTA.
- Make CTAs visually appealing: Use contrasting colors, whitespace, and compelling graphics to draw attention to your CTAs.
- Place CTAs strategically: Position your CTAs prominently on your website, such as in the header, sidebar, or at the end of blog posts.
8. Utilizing SEO Strategies for Ethical Hackers
Search engine optimization (SEO) is crucial for increasing your website’s visibility in search engine results pages. Implementing SEO strategies helps drive organic traffic to your website and improves its overall ranking. Here are some SEO tips for ethical hackers:
- Keyword research: Identify relevant keywords and incorporate them naturally into your website’s content, headings, and meta tags.
- High-quality content: Create informative and engaging content that is valuable to your target audience. Regularly update your website with fresh content to attract search engine crawlers.
- Proper URL structure: Use descriptive URLs that include relevant keywords to improve search engine indexing.
- Mobile optimization: As mentioned earlier, optimize your website for mobile devices to comply with search engine requirements.
Now, let’s move on to the Frequently Asked Questions section.
Frequently Asked Questions (FAQ):
Q1: How can I balance aesthetics and security in web design?
A1: Balancing aesthetics and security can be achieved by selecting a color palette and typography that evoke trust, while also incorporating secure features like SSL encryption and two-factor authentication.
Q2: What is the significance of mobile optimization for ethical hackers?
A2: Mobile optimization ensures that your website is accessible and user-friendly on smartphones and tablets. It expands your reach and improves user experience, leading to higher engagement and conversions.
Q3: How can I improve my website’s performance and speed?
A3: Enhancing website performance and speed can be done by optimizing images, minifying code, enabling caching, and using a content delivery network (CDN) to reduce latency.
Q4: Why is SEO important for ethical hackers?
A4: SEO helps increase your website’s visibility in search engine results, driving organic traffic and improving rankings. It is crucial for reaching a wider audience and establishing credibility.
Conclusion
Creating an effective web design as an ethical hacker requires a careful balance between aesthetics, user experience, and security. By following the tips outlined in this blog post, you can enhance your website’s visual appeal, optimize its performance, and ensure the safety of your users. Remember to always stay up to date with the latest web design trends and security practices to maintain a strong online presence. Happy designing and hacking!